After the 1979 Iranian Revolution, Moein immigrated to the United States. His first major breakthrough came with the 1982 album Yeki Ra Doost Midaram , which turned him into a global star for Iranians both at home and abroad. After the 1979 Iranian Revolution, Moein immigrated to
The Cyrillic title you provided ("Беҳтарин Сурудҳо") highlights his massive popularity in Tajikistan, where his music is considered a bridge between Persian-speaking cultures.
